Output 142cfd49d66d25ee11bf7dac5c48b86780a3bfd2a6ed24045b872cc921349449:1

value
13897054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e81e42d23b5f2768533448da7a8c2c2b1959d2 OP_EQUAL
address
3MC3vFztQScV2t4iajV3dpWPoTfEaT8RDs
transaction
142cfd49d66d25ee11bf7dac5c48b86780a3bfd2a6ed24045b872cc921349449
spent
true